Q: What Is An Advance Directive?

A: An advance directive is a written or oral statement, which is made and witnessed in advance of serious illness or injury, about how you want medical decisions made. Two forms of advance directives are:

-  "Living Will"
-  Healthcare Surrogate Designation

An advance directive allows you to state your choices about healthcare or to name someone to make those choices for you if you become unable to make decisions about your medical treatment. An advance directive can enable you to make decisions about your future medical treatment.
